Type
ORACLE
Validation date
2024-11-23 08:43: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02022,
    "usd": 0.02107
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016223984C5A8ECEC7A20590437A238C2D9FF29726BB44064C4E752C8B5C336E40

Previous signature

8FC8155974EC3941A636601195498A8961D893FE0ADA601BED517DA4FE836B9D7C875EA07A6FB2E0B7D7E269A8102CC67B21AD04158B164DE705603F50CC6F0D

Origin signature

304402206EAAEDB5D7BDFC90FEF2FECDA516482BD683B0E12CF590A797FFC6F27D0754F6022053909FA9D35003FF1CC3C46978B49CDCC54515D6AF111B647969770FABE14CDB

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00F86CC49AC117E71CEA0F373B076E35889F7383F201467A600FE0A5E1972C4E28

Coordinator signature

55C7E5E105591355310F5B7C325FC9A77891E0506C7984D1BDD646D36B4F7372579E9438C540F6AD836621486540D154FFE1E36C06CBD9CB36245D90DCB95C06

Validator #1 public key

0001EC6E55F66EF1FB64146A826C46268B1995E8EC834680FB3E41C831DB6613E255

Validator #1 signature

55AA42940135362A9B0FCE5DB58E5FAD8F82F2AB79F80DE577ED8FDD87D4219957E3DFB2DD543B9186E05F59CD287F71CB70B7C5E6FFEAD545837BEA041E8909

Validator #2 public key

0001FDCD194785B82F4E02D02764800593CB3F2D7262D5F802BAC4A91CFD338F3963

Validator #2 signature

3E4C92391A20F632050ADAB94A3C613549659B0B9EB1D72A0191706D116043E321CF284B2A54ECEA53C5419C1ED60DFBB5932BF17F7C75BB50858D28C03A3B02